ESG composite score calculator combines Environmental, Social, and Governance dimensions into single rating. E:75 + S:60 + G:80 with equal weights = 71.7 composite. ESG ratings used by investors to screen holdings, by companies to track progress, by employees evaluating employer impact. MSCI, Sustainalytics, Refinitiv all publish ESG ratings.
Example: company scoring E:75 (strong climate practices), S:60 (decent labour relations), G:80 (excellent board composition). Equal-weighted composite: (75+60+80)/3 = 71.7. B rating (above average). Different providers weight differently - MSCI weights by industry materiality (oil company E weighted higher than software company E). Composite score useful for cross-company comparison.
ESG investing growth: sustainable and ESG-aligned assets now run into the tens of trillions globally (industry estimates vary). Active ESG funds, ESG ETFs, exclusion-based funds (no tobacco/weapons). Performance debate: ESG-aligned funds have historically been reported as matching or slightly outperforming the broad market, with some research finding reduced tail risk and other research finding the opposite. Critical issues: greenwashing (companies claiming ESG without substance), inconsistent ratings (same company different scores from different providers), regulation tightening (disclosure frameworks such as TCFD and regional climate-disclosure rules).

Methodology
This calculator computes a composite ESG score by taking a weighted average of three component scores: environmental, social, and governance. Each component score is multiplied by its assigned weight (expressed as a percentage), the products are summed, and the total is divided by 100 to normalize the result. The model assumes that the three weights sum to 100 percent and that each input score falls between 0 and 100. The calculator does not adjust scores for data quality, market conditions, time periods, or relative materiality across sectors. Results reflect only the arithmetic combination of inputs as specified and do not account for correlation between ESG dimensions or qualitative factors that may influence investment outcomes.
